Decker is one of only a few WRs who are equally dangerous in the slot and on the outside boundary routes.
He is by physique and nature a natural #3/"Z" flanker, but can handle #2/"Y"/slot duty with the best of them & about as dangerous as a good TE on shallow crossing routes that start outside and slant into the middle.
